-
JavaScriptDate对象易在时区、字符串解析、月份索引(0起始)处出错;ISO字符串如'2023-10-01'被解析为UTC再转本地,导致跨浏览器差异;安全做法是显式指定时区或用数值构造,避免模糊字符串解析。
-
若豆包AI生成图片偏离预期,主因是入口错误、提示词模糊或参数不当;应依次进入官方图像生成功能、编写结构化提示词、合理配置参数、筛选四宫格结果,并通过关键词升级、拆分描述等方式迭代优化。
-
PHP中清理查询结果空值应避免array_filter()默认行为,需显式过滤null和空字符串,保留0、false等合法值;对JSON或嵌套数组需递归处理;最佳实践是在PDOfetch阶段预处理,并统一数据库空值定义。
-
Go服务应通过stdout+Filebeat采集日志,避免直连Logstash;使用zap输出结构化JSON,配置Filebeatmultiline、编码及rotate策略确保日志不被切碎、不丢数据、字段可被Kibana正确解析。
-
使用Ctrl+F快速打开查找功能,输入文本即可高亮匹配项;也可通过“开始”选项卡中的“查找”按钮进入高级查找界面;部分笔记本需用Fn+Ctrl+F,或用Ctrl+H通过替换框实现查找。
-
答案:下载解密PHP文件需合法授权,常见加密方式有ZendGuard、ionCube等,可通过官方工具或运行时调试尝试恢复,但须遵守法律与道德规范。
-
let声明的变量存在暂时性死区(TDZ),未声明前访问抛出ReferenceError;var会被提升并初始化为undefined,访问不报错。for循环中var共享绑定,let每次迭代新建绑定。let禁止重复声明,var允许。
-
空格本身不干扰爬虫,真正问题是DOM结构脆弱、选择器过度依赖格式或服务端渲染变更;B站div末尾空格致CSS选择器失效,因>要求严格子元素关系;BeautifulSoup保留原始空白,lxml更宽容但xpath可能捕获前导空白;需区分处理文本、属性值及 实体;pandas.read_html对表格最鲁棒;空格频发本质是SSR转向CSR,应优先检测原始响应,转向API或无头浏览器。
-
答案:CSS中position:relative使元素在原位置进行视觉偏移,但仍占据文档流空间,常用于为absolute子元素提供定位基准;而position:absolute使元素脱离文档流,不占空间,相对于最近的已定位祖先元素定位,若无则以初始包含块为基准。两者核心区别在于是否脱离文档流及定位参照物不同,合理使用可实现精准布局,滥用则易导致响应式问题和定位错乱。
-
Excel导入班级通信录需精准识别空值:先trim()和标准化全角空格,再用===''严格判断;区分必填与可选字段,按业务规则处理;读取时用calculateWorksheetDimension()获取真实数据范围,避免空行;数据库字段应设DEFAULTNULL,并确保PHP层不插入未赋值字段。
-
使用Go语言结合github.com/fogleman/gg库生成验证码,先安装依赖;2.通过generateRandomString函数从数字字母中随机生成指定长度字符串;3.调用rand.Seed初始化随机种子确保多样性;4.利用gg绘制背景、彩色文本和干扰线等元素创建图像。
-
白鞋泛黄可用牙膏与小苏打混合刷洗,再用卫生纸包裹阴干防黄;顽固黄渍可选专用清洁剂或泡泡粉处理;局部发黄用橡皮擦擦拭;淘米水浸泡亦可天然增白。
-
Pythonsignal模块仅主线程有效,子线程注册handler不触发;SIGKILL、SIGSTOP不可捕获,SIGCONThandler不执行;SIGCHLD需循环waitpid防僵尸;推荐用Event/Queue替代信号通信。
-
API限流通过限制单位时间内请求次数保护服务器资源,防止恶意攻击与数据爬取,确保服务公平稳定。在PHP中常结合Redis实现,采用计数器、滑动窗口、令牌桶或漏桶算法,其中固定窗口计数器因实现简单且高效被广泛使用,核心依赖Redis的原子操作如INCR和EXPIRE来保证并发安全与自动重置,同时需返回429状态码及限流信息提升用户体验。
-
React要求自定义组件名必须以大写字母开头,否则JSX会将其识别为原生HTML标签(如<banner>被当作<banner></banner>未知标签处理),导致组件不渲染且无报错提示。修正命名并修复拼写错误后即可正常显示。